A+ ExamNotes: Core 1 (220-1101) & Core 2 (220-1102)

The A+ certification is divided into two exams: Core 1 (220-1101) and Core 2 (220-1102). Core 1 focuses heavily on hardware and networking, while Core 2 covers operating systems, software, security, and operational procedures.

The A+ 220-1101 exam encompasses five main domains and 33 sub-domains. This exam focuses on hardware, which is similar to the hardware and software split in the earliest A+ certification exam format. This is especially true as many modern hardware problems are addressed through applications.

The A+ 220-1102 exam has four domains and 35 sub-domains. The A+ 220-1102 exam covers the various software, operating system and security issues that can appear on the test.
